Singareni implements Rs 10 lakh free insurance scheme for natural deaths

Union Bank has expanded its existing Rs 1 crore accident insurance scheme for Singareni employees to include natural death coverage of Rs 10 lakh. The initiative, guided by Singareni CMD Dr Buddhaprakash Jyoti and Director Gowtham Potru, came into effect on April 1, 2026.

Peddapalli: Union Bank, which has already been implementing a Rs 1 crore accident insurance scheme for Singareni employees, has now decided to extend free insurance coverage for natural death as well, following the suggestions made by Singareni management.

As per the decision communicated by the bank, all employees and officers holding corporate salary accounts with Union Bank will be eligible for Rs 10 lakh insurance coverage in case of death, including natural causes.

This decision was taken as a result of the initiative and guidance of Singareni Chairman and Managing Director Dr Buddhaprakash Jyoti, along with the special efforts of Director (Personnel & Finance) Gowtham Potru. The bank confirmed that the scheme has come into effect from April 1, 2026.

It may be recalled here that in 2024, with the initiative of the State Government, Union Bank implemented a Rs 1 crore free accident insurance scheme for Singareni workers. As a continuation of that agreement, the bank has now extended insurance coverage of Rs 10 lakh for natural death as well. The decision has been widely welcomed by employees and stakeholders.
